Architecture et composants Power BI : comment ça marche ?

Publié: 2020-03-17

Power BI est l'une des solutions d'analyse de données les plus populaires sur le marché. Qu'est-ce que c'est? Quels sont ses composants ? Et comment ça marche ? Vous le découvrirez dans cet article complet.

Nous allons examiner l' architecture de Power BI et son fonctionnement. Alors, sans plus tarder, commençons.

Table des matières

Qu'est-ce que Power BI ?

Produit de Microsoft, Power BI est un service d'analyse commerciale . Il vous fournit des visualisations interactives et des solutions de business intelligence. Il a une interface extrêmement facile à utiliser, il y a donc une courbe d'apprentissage minimale pour tout débutant.

Il vous permet de vous connecter à diverses sources de données et d'utiliser Power Query pour simplifier la transformation, l'ingestion et l'intégration. Il a plusieurs visuels intégrés et a également la fonctionnalité de création visuelle personnalisée. Les capacités collaboratives de ce logiciel en font également un incontournable pour de nombreuses entreprises.

Lisez aussi: 29 questions et réponses d'entretien Power BI les plus courantes

Architecture Power BI

Pour mieux comprendre ce logiciel, vous devriez jeter un œil à l' architecture Power Bi , qui est composée de plusieurs composants. Nous avons discuté de chacun de ces composants en détail dans les points suivants :

Source des données

Power BI dispose d'une pléthore de sources de données. Comme il est compatible avec une variété de sources de données, vous n'avez pas à vous inquiéter à cet égard. Vous pouvez importer des données à partir de sources en ligne ou d'un fichier dans votre stockage local. Il a une limite de 1 Go si vous importez des données à partir de sources de données en ligne ou sur site.

Les principales sources de données prises en charge par Power BI sont les suivantes :

  • GitHub
  • Facebook
  • Google Analytics
  • Salesforce (Rapports)
  • Impala
  • Base de données Sybase
  • XML
  • JSON
  • Redshift d'Amazon
  • SAP HANA
  • Base de données MySQL
  • Base de données Oracle
  • Base de données Teradata
  • Exceller
  • Base de données SQL Azure
  • CSV/Texte
  • HDFS (stockage Hadoop)
  • Étincelle
  • Dynamique 365
  • MailChimp

La liste est assez exhaustive, mais vous pouvez comprendre quelle variété vous obtenez lorsque vous jetez un œil aux sources de données de cette solution.

Bureau Power BI

Vous pouvez également installer Power Bi sur votre PC, et ce composant téléchargeable de Power Bi est Power BI Desktop. Il s'agit d'une solution logicielle côté client dotée de plusieurs outils et fonctionnalités permettant de connecter des sources de données, d'effectuer une modélisation des données et de générer des rapports. La meilleure chose à propos de cet outil est qu'il est gratuit.

Cela signifie que vous n'avez pas à payer de frais pour l'utiliser. Vous pouvez le télécharger et commencer à l'utiliser immédiatement. Il dispose d'une interface "glisser-déposer" qui rend la visualisation des données très facile.

De nombreuses fonctionnalités sont présentes dans ce logiciel de bureau, notamment la possibilité de définir la relation entre différents ensembles de données, de créer des modèles de données et des visuels et de publier des rapports. La plupart des professionnels de l'informatique décisionnelle utilisent le bureau Power BI pour créer des rapports.

En savoir plus : Business Analytics : outils, applications et avantages

Service Power BI

Power BI vous fournit également un service sur le cloud, appelé service Power BI. Il s'agit d'une plateforme en ligne qui vous permet de publier et de partager les rapports que vous créez sur Power BI Desktop. Le service Power BI vous permet de collaborer avec d'autres sur vos rapports et de créer des tableaux de bord en conséquence.

Il existe de nombreux noms pour cette solution, notamment le « site Power BI » et le « portail Web Power BI ». Il a une version gratuite ainsi que deux versions payantes, à savoir Pro et Premium.

La version Pro vous offre la possibilité de surveiller la BI dans le cloud et d'effectuer des analyses ad hoc en dehors de la publication, de la collaboration et du partage.

D'autre part, la version Premium dispose de contrôles de déploiement et d'administration avancés. Il a des capacités pour effectuer des analyses de données volumineuses et des rapports sur le cloud.

Serveur de rapports Power BI

Ce composant est assez similaire à celui dont nous avons parlé précédemment (Service Power BI). La différence est que Power BI Report Server est une solution sur site et non une solution basée sur le cloud. C'est pour les entreprises qui préfèrent garder leurs données avec elles et qui veulent éviter d'utiliser le stockage en nuage.

Vous bénéficiez des mêmes fonctionnalités que dans le service Power BI, telles que la génération de rapports, la création de tableaux de bord et le partage de rapports avec d'autres membres de l'équipe. Vous devez avoir un abonnement Power BI Premium si vous souhaitez utiliser cette solution.

Passerelle Power BI

La passerelle Power BI permet des transferts de données sécurisés entre deux utilisateurs. Il connecte les sources de données sur site. Vous pouvez transférer les données entre le stockage sur site et les services cloud. Vous disposez de nombreuses options lorsque vous choisissez un service cloud, notamment Power BI, PowerApps, Microsoft Flow, Azure Analysis et Azure Logic Apps.

Power BI intégré

Power BI Embedded vous fournit des API que vous pouvez utiliser pour intégrer des tableaux de bord et des rapports dans des applications personnalisées. Il s'agit d'un service sur site dans Azure.

Power BI Mobile

Les applications Power BI Mobile vous permettent de vous connecter à vos données sur site ou stockées dans le cloud depuis n'importe où en utilisant votre mobile. Ce composant améliore l'accessibilité de l'architecture Power BI car vous pouvez accéder à vos données de n'importe où et à tout moment. Les applications mobiles de Power BI sont disponibles pour les téléphones iOS, Android et Windows.

Outre les principaux composants de l'architecture Power BI dont nous avons discuté ici, il existe de nombreux autres petits composants qui jouent également un rôle crucial. Certains de ces composants sont :

  • Pivot de puissance
  • Requête Power BI
  • Cartes de puissance
  • Questions et réponses sur l'alimentation
  • Vue de puissance

Opérations Power BI – Comment ça marche ?

Maintenant que vous connaissez les différentes parties de l'architecture Power BI, examinons son fonctionnement. Tout d'abord, les données circulent dans les parties de Power BI à partir des sources. Comme nous l'avons déjà mentionné, Power BI vous permet de vous connecter à différents types de sources de données. Vous pouvez transférer les données présentes dans ces sources vers le bureau Power BI.

Là, vous pouvez créer, développer et publier des rapports. Si vous utilisez des services sur site, vous transférerez les données vers le service Power BI. Et si vous utilisez des services basés sur le cloud, vous l'enverrez via la passerelle Power BI vers le cloud.

Dernières pensées

Nous espérons que vous avez trouvé cet article utile. Comme vous pouvez le voir, Microsoft Power BI est un outil incroyable capable d'effectuer une variété de tâches d'analyse de données. De la collaboration à l'accès facile, il dispose de nombreuses fonctionnalités pour simplifier la visualisation des données.

Si vous souhaitez en savoir plus sur Power BI, Big Data, Data Science et Machine Learning, consultez notre blog .

Si vous êtes curieux d'en savoir plus sur Power BI, sur la science des données, consultez le diplôme PG de IIIT-B & upGrad en science des données qui est créé pour les professionnels en activité et propose plus de 10 études de cas et projets, des ateliers pratiques, du mentorat avec l'industrie experts, 1-on-1 avec des mentors de l'industrie, plus de 400 heures d'apprentissage et d'aide à l'emploi avec les meilleures entreprises.

Pourquoi mon rapport Power BI est-il si lent ?

Power BI est un outil assez célèbre utilisé par les entreprises pour générer des tableaux de bord et des rapports afin de prendre des décisions efficaces pour l'entreprise. Power BI est un outil rapide pour gérer d'énormes bases de données, mais vous pourriez vous retrouver à attendre longtemps avant que les visuels ne soient chargés sur le rapport.

De nombreuses raisons expliquent les mauvaises performances de tout rapport Power BI. Si vous utilisez trop de graphiques, laissez certaines options par défaut, utilisez des graphiques personnalisés non certifiés ou utilisez une énorme quantité de données, il y a de fortes chances que les performances soient faibles et que le rapport soit lent. Cela peut amener Power BI à faire des efforts supplémentaires pour le chargement et à augmenter le temps d'attente.

Quand ne pas utiliser Power BI ?

Microsoft Power BI est un outil assez puissant pour générer des rapports visuels et des tableaux de bord pour toutes vos données. Cela facilite l'étude des modèles et des tendances en fonction des données disponibles affichées avec des visuels. Habituellement, les développeurs préfèrent utiliser Power BI dans la majorité des cas, mais il existe certains cas où vous devez éviter d'utiliser Power BI.

Comment rendre Power BI plus rapide ?

Power BI est un outil très populaire pour créer des rapports et des tableaux de bord à partir de zéro en fonction des données disponibles. Lorsque vous ajoutez trop de widgets et de fonctionnalités, vous remarquerez que Power BI devient extrêmement lent et difficile à utiliser. C'est là que vous devez utiliser certaines techniques pour simplifier le travail de Power BI et le rendre assez rapide pour vous. Certains d'entre eux utilisent des nombres entiers partout où cela est possible, supprimant tout ce qui n'est pas utilisé, s'en tenant aux widgets Power BI par défaut et utilisant les N premières lignes dans d'énormes tables d'ensembles de données.